#0e1b66 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0e1b66 is composed of 5.5% red, 10.6%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.3% cyan, 73.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 231.1 degrees, a saturation of 75.9% and a lightness of 22.7%. #0e1b66 color hex could be obtained by blending #1c36cc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

● #0e1b66 color description : Very dark blue.
#0e1b66 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0e1b66 has RGB values of R:14, G:27,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 924518.
